How is the chicken raised?

Our birds are free-range and pasture-raised with room to roam, then air-chilled rather than water-chilled for firmer texture and cleaner flavour. No added hormones.

What do Skin-on, Skinless and Boneless mean?

Skin-on keeps the natural skin for crispy roasting and grilling. Skinless removes it for leaner cooking. Boneless removes the bone for fillets and quick cooking — priced a little higher for the extra prep.
